Professional Biography

Hope Goldstein is a Shareholder in Vedder Price’s Dallas and New York offices and a member of the firm’s Labor & Employment group.

Ms. Goldstein’s practice covers a wide range of issues concerning employers, and she provides both traditional labor law and employment law advice and litigation services. She has extensive experience representing clients in matters involving compliance with the National Labor Relations Act, labor negotiations and arbitrations, mergers and acquisitions, labor crisis management and long-term workforce strategies. More specifically, she negotiates, drafts and implements collective bargaining agreements, extension agreements and shutdown agreements. In addition, Ms. Goldstein’s employment law practice includes defending employers against discrimination, harassment, retaliation and the full range of statutory and common law employment claims.

Ms. Goldstein defends state and federal wage and hour and child labor investigations, conducts wage and hour audits, and assists clients with all aspects of wage and hour compliance. She negotiates and prepares employment agreements, settlement agreements, separation and severance agreements, and noncompete, nondisclosure and confidentiality agreements; drafts employment applications, policies and handbooks; and counsels clients on federal and state employment law compliance on topics such as hiring, terminations, working conditions and leave issues related to the ADA, FMLA and state leave laws. 

Ms. Goldstein advises clients on business start-up-related employment issues. She also negotiates merger and acquisition agreement provisions relevant to employment and employee benefits issues; advises clients on reductions in force, WARN and state plant closing law issues; and counsels clients on the development and implementation of the employment aspects of reorganization plans.
